Starbucks Cream Cheese Danish

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 6 danishes

Ingredients

– 1 sheet of frozen puff pastry for optimal flakiness in the base

– 4 ounces of softened cream cheese provides the rich, creamy filling

– 2 and 1/2 tablespoons of granulated sugar adds the perfect sweetness to balance flavors

– 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ract enhances the depth of flavor in the mixture

– 1/4 teaspoon of salt brings out the taste with a subtle hint

– 1 egg used for the egg wash to create a golden, glossy finish

– 1 tablespoon of water mixed with the egg for the wash

Instructions

1-Preheat your oven: preheating your oven to 400Β°F (204Β°C) and lining a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.

2-Thaw the puff pastry: Thaw the 1 sheet of frozen puff pastry until it’s easy to handle, keeping it cold for the best texture.

3-Prepare the filling: In a bowl, blend the 4 ounces of softened cream cheese with 2 and 1/2 tablespoons of granulated sugar, 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ract, and 1/4 teaspoon of salt until the mixture is smooth and creamy.

4-Roll and cut the pastry: Roll out the puff pastry and cut it into six equal rectangles, then place them on the prepared baking sheet.

5-Add the cream cheese filling: Pipe or spread the cream cheese mixture down the center of each rectangle, leaving about a half-inch border to avoid overflow.

6-Prepare the egg wash: For the egg wash, whisk together 1 egg with 1 tablespoon of water and brush it on the edges of the pastries.

7-Bake the danishes: Bake the danishes for 15 to 16 minutes until they are puffed and golden, then cool them on a wire rack.

8-Optional enhancements: You can add optional enhancements like chocolate chips in the filling or lemon zest for a subtle tartness.

9-Serving suggestion: Once ready, these cream cheese danish treats can be topped with fresh fruits for added elegance, making them ideal for travelers or baking enthusiasts.

Notes

❄️ Use cold puff pastry to ensure maximum flakiness during baking.
πŸ₯„ Avoid overfilling the pastries to prevent leakage during baking.
🧊 Leftovers store well refrigerated for up to three days and freeze well for up to three months.
